Saint Rose of Lima

Saint Rose of Lima was born on April 20th 1586 in the small, beautiful town of Lima, Peru. Her feast day is August 23rd and her baptismal name is Isabel. She had a great devotion to God as well as Saint Catherine of Sienna. An interesting fact of Saint Rose is that she was the very first canonized American. She is the patron saint of Americans; people ridiculed for their piety; and she is also against vanity. She is so against it that she rubbed peppers on her face to make it less beautiful. She accepted all her sufferings cheerfully and lived each day as faithful as the last. She recieved many mental and physical sufferings.
    She died at the young age of 31 in 1617 and she was canonized in 1671 as a Saint.
